Born in Tien Dien commune, Tran Minh Hoang grew up in a family where both parents are teachers. Ms. Tran Thi Thu Hoa - Minh Hoang's mother said: "Even before entering first grade, Hoang had the ability to read and calculate simple calculations. Hoang's love of Mathematics was inspired and nurtured every day by his parents and teachers in his hometown".

For Hoang, studying Math not only gives him knowledge but also helps him practice logical thinking and supports his studies in other subjects. His talent, passion for Math and his efforts to explore, discover and conquer the subject have helped Hoang win many impressive awards before winning the International Math Olympiad Gold Medal. He is also known as a "high-level exam specialist".
In grade 8, Hoang won first prize in the Provincial Math Competition for Grade 9 students. In grade 9, he rose to the top of the class. He also won many awards at international math competitions such as: Gold medal in the English Math Olympiad (SEAMO) in 2019; Silver medal in the Singapore Math Olympiad (SMO) in 2019; Gold medal in the Singapore and Asian Math Olympiad (SASMO) in 2019; Special prize in the Young Math Talent Search (MYTS) in 2019; Gold medal in the Iran Geometry Olympiad for Intermediate level in 2022...
In the 2022-2023 school year, right after becoming a student at Ha Tinh High School for the Gifted, although he was only a 10th grader, Hoang took the exam to advance to a higher level and won first prize in the National Excellent Student Competition. In the 11th grade, Hoang won a silver medal at the International Mathematical Olympiad.
Not stopping there, with a progressive spirit, perseverance, and a special love for Mathematics, the student from Ha Tinh quietly broke through, and then this year, in his last return to IMO, Hoang made his dream of changing the color of his medal come true.

Mr. Tran Dinh Huu - homeroom teacher of Math 1 class 12, who has been with Hoang for 3 years at Ha Tinh High School for the Gifted, shared: “This exam is very stressful for Hoang, because he sets a goal to surpass himself with the desire to change the color of the medal. Accompanying him during the days of focused review in Hanoi, I know that the journey to achieve his goal of winning a gold medal is not easy. Behind the halo are months of hard study, sleepless nights with hundreds of difficult math problems, times of fatigue to the point of thinking he could not continue, but he never stopped. Hoang is diligent, hard-working, has a strong learning ability and very deep thinking, he has the ability to stay calm very well, that is the most important thing in stressful international exams”.

With intelligence, courage and perseverance, Hoang has surpassed himself, overcome the shadow of the silver medal in 2024 to reach the dream he once cherished - the prestigious gold medal. He is also the first student from Ha Tinh to win 2 consecutive medals in Mathematics in 2 international Olympics.
Mr. Hoang Ba Hung - Principal of Ha Tinh High School for the Gifted said: "Accompanying Hoang and the teachers and the Math team during the competition days in Australia, I admire the will and determination of the students in the team even more. As for Minh Hoang, because he had experience from the previous competition, he entered the competition proactively and had a stable competition strategy. Although there is still some regret, with a score of 35, Hoang's efforts have been duly recognized."
